Quantum entanglement brings bright prospects for the development of new technologies and will create the future quantum earth. Quantum walks are also the result of the entanglement of coins and position spaces, exhibiting very different characteristics than classical random walks. Quantum walks can provide exponential speedups compared to classical algorithms in some applications due to iterative shift and coin operators. Here, we mainly discuss two very different applications: fundamental physics and big data analytics.
